UK Phantom production spies European growth

2 June 2011


Metal detector specialist Fortress Technology has invested £2million to achieve service, production and cost benefits by manufacturing its Phantom metal detectors for the UK and European food and pharmaceutical industries from a new 10,500ft2 facility in Banbury.

The company has more than trebled headcount during the past 12 months, it says.

Managing Director at Fortress Sarah Ketchin calls the new plant an ‘important milestone’ for the business. “Up to now it has solely concentrated on manufacture at its headquarters in Canada and from a production unit in Brazil,” she explains.

She adds: “We have already shipped a number of metal detectors from the UK and look forward to further expansion both in the domestic market and overseas.”

Further news from Fortress is the launch of its 'groundbreaking' metal detector with a touch screen front panel with membrane interface, designed to be future proof and said to be easily retrofitted to older models in the Phantom series. The Icon delivers 'fast accurate detection of metal contaminants, and detailed data collection' states the company.
